Do You Need a Fence Permit in Duluth?

Based on Duluth's local building codes, you'll need a permit when:

Required·Rule 1

Fences over 6 feet require a building permit.

SourceCity of Duluth Code / MN State Building Code / 2012 IRC

These fence projects are typically exempt in Duluth:

Exempt·Rule 1

Backyard fences 6 feet or under typically do not require a building permit.

SourceCity of Duluth Code / MN State Building Code / 2012 IRC
Exempt·Rule 2

Front yard fences 4 feet or under typically do not require a permit but must comply with zoning.

SourceCity of Duluth Code / MN State Building Code / 2012 IRC

Permit Fees in Duluth

Based on local Duluth permit data, fees for fence projects typically range:

$50 – $200 Duluth Permit Fee Range

Here's how fees break down by project scope nationally:

Project ScopeTypical Permit Fee
Simple residential fence (under 6 ft)$25 – $150
Front-yard or taller fence (6+ ft)$50 – $200
Masonry or engineered fence$150 – $500+
Pool barrier fence$50 – $200
Inspection fee (if separate from permit)$25 – $85
Structural engineering (masonry walls, if required)$500 – $2,000+ (separate from permit)

Fees are typically calculated based on estimated project value. Contact Construction Services & Inspections for exact amounts.

Required Inspections in Duluth

Most fence projects in Duluth require inspections at each construction stage:

Inspection·Stage 1

Post Hole / Footing Inspection, Hole depth (typically 1/3 to 1/2 of the above-ground post height, and below the frost line in cold climates), hole diameter (typically 3x the post width), bearing on undisturbed soil, correct post locations matching the approved site plan, and proper setback from property lines and easements.

WhenAfter holes are dug but before concrete is poured or backfill is placed, this is the most common fence inspection
Common FailuresHoles not deep enough, posts placed within an easement, fence location doesn't match the approved site plan, holes not below the frost line.
Inspection·Stage 2

Final Inspection, Overall height compliance with the approved plans, correct location and setbacks, structural integrity, proper gate operation, material compliance, 'good side out' compliance (if applicable), and general code compliance. For pool barrier fences: self-closing gates, self-latching mechanism at 54 inches, no climbable features, and no openings larger than 4 inches.

WhenAfter the fence is fully installed, posts, rails, pickets/panels, and gates
Common FailuresFence exceeds approved height, gate doesn't self-close properly (pool fences), fence not matching the approved location, 'good side' facing inward instead of outward.

Schedule inspections with Construction Services & Inspections at (218) 730-5240 at least 24–48 hours in advance.
